Birth Injury

The process of childbirth can be a challenging one, and may cause injuries to both the mother and baby. Erb's palsy, which is caused by a doctor's use excessive force or traction in the course of delivery, is a common birth injury that can happen as a result of medical negligence.

The condition is caused by injury to the brachial nerves that control movement of the shoulder, arm, and hand. Erb's palsy can cause severe physical limitations, such as the sensation of numbness, pain, and difficulties moving the affected arm. In some cases the injured arm could never fully heal.

Trials

A lawyer who has experience in Erb's Palsy can help you file a claim against the medical professionals who caused your child's condition. This may include financial compensation for medical costs, the cost of future treatment, and the cost of life-long care.

Erb's palsy is caused by damage to the brachialplexus bundle that connects the baby's spinal cord to their hands and arms. The condition usually occurs in cases of shoulder dystocia or other complications during childbirth. A New York City erb’s palsy attorney can evaluate your situation to determine if your child's injuries result from medical malpractice or negligence.

The most effective way to secure compensation for your child's erb's palsy is to negotiate a settlement with the doctor or hospital accountable for their injuries. Certain claims are not resolved and will need to be decided by a court. A trial is a chance for your family to provide evidence of your child's injuries and the way they occurred. A judge or jury will then determine how much you are entitled to receive.
